Starz Bulks Up Vongo Slate with Screen Media Ventures Deal
Internet-Download Service Adds More than 100 Feature Films
By Glen Dickson -- Broadcasting & Cable, 10/1/2007 8:28:00 PM
Starz Entertainment increased the content offered through its Vongo subscription online-video service by acquiring multiyear broadband-distribution rights to more than 100 feature films from Delaware-based Screen Media Ventures.
The agreement with SMV will allow Starz to provide the movies to subscribers to Vongo's unlimited download service, as well as renting them online on a 24-hour pay-per-view basis. Select movies will also be available for electronic sell-through purchase when Vongo adds that functionality in the future.
Among the new titles are cult horror film Piranha; comedy Mojave Moon with Angelina Jolie, Danny Aiello and Anne Archer; Will Ferrell vehicle Men Seeking Women; and Blue Desert, a thriller starring Courtney Cox-Arquette.

Vongo subscribers currently have unlimited access to more than 1,000 movies and 2,500 total video selections, as well as a live, streaming Starz TV channel for $9.99 per month.
